Introducing Pontiac Solstice. It's an innovative take on the classic roadster where sleek lines and a seamless top-down appearance complement superb styling. Meanwhile, the wide, aggressive road stance portrays the crisp handling and quick response beneath the exterior. Connect with every element of your perfect open air driving experience in the new 2006 Pontiac Solstice.

177 hp 2.4L ECOTEC DOHC L4 VVT engine
AISIN short throw 5-speed manual transmission
All-steel unibody construction
Standard 18" aluminum wheels
Ergonomic contoured seats
****pit-style instrument panel
Available two-tone European-inspired interior
Available leather-appointed seating surfaces
4-wheel independent SLA suspension
Road-responsive Bilstein Monotube shocks
4-wheel disc brakes
Available OnStar°
2006 Solstice, base MSRP starting from $25,695
